Output 61aebd873195ce65f4b9925868e89ffbbc752c4e3e8b5437dee7e213767e37ec:1

value
11571705
script pubkey
OP_0 OP_PUSHBYTES_20 72c0e2e4f39c93824284960daa8d012b66cba059
address
bc1qwtqw9e8nnjfcys5yjcx64rgp9dnvhgzeevg3rf
transaction
61aebd873195ce65f4b9925868e89ffbbc752c4e3e8b5437dee7e213767e37ec
confirmations
152784
spent
true